#105313 na your all set.. just havent seen that on our years before..

but that ball joint might be toast.. with the boot open like that it get drity and fails.. chould cause the shake 100%. Put a jack under the lower control arm and put a pry bar under the tire and pry up.. see if there is play.. if its really bad you can do it with your hands by puting your hands 12:00 and 6:00 and pushing in and out. it should be no movement if good..

if thats not it then im guessing its rotors.. you chould have a shop check them for out of round and maybe resurface them..
